72" white oak trestle table with a breadboard-free floating top. Built to survive children.
| Part | Qty | T × W × L | Material | ✓ |
|---|---|---|---|---|
| Top boards Glued edge to edge for a ~36" x 72" top. Cut 2" long, trim after glue-up. | 6 | 1 3/4" × 6" × 74" | White Oak | ☐ |
| Trestle feet | 2 | 2 3/4" × 4 1/2" × 30" | White Oak | ☐ |
| Trestle posts | 2 | 2 3/4" × 5" × 26" | White Oak | ☐ |
| Trestle top cleats | 2 | 2 3/4" × 4 1/2" × 26" | White Oak | ☐ |
| Stretcher Ties the two trestles together. Through-tenoned and wedged. | 1 | 1 3/4" × 5" × 50" | White Oak | ☐ |

| White oak, 8/4, for the top (White Oak) ~$8/bd ft. Buy 20% more than the math says — you will reject boards for cup and defects. | 30 board feet | ☐ |
| White oak or ash, 8/4, for the trestle base (White Oak) | 16 board feet | ☐ |
| Figure-8 tabletop fasteners The single most important hardware in this build. They let the top expand and contract while staying attached. | 10 each | ☐ |
| Wood glue | 24 oz | ☐ |
| Clear interior finish (hardwax oil or wipe-on poly) A dining table gets wine, water, and hot plates. Hardwax oil repairs locally; film finishes look better longer but must be stripped to repair. | 32 oz | ☐ |

Bring the oak into your shop and sticker it for at least a week. Lumberyard moisture content is not your house's moisture content, and a top glued up from wood that hasn't settled will cup after you deliver it.
This is the least glamorous step and the one that most often decides whether the table survives.
Tools: Combination Square, Jointer, Thickness Planer. Materials: White oak, 8/4, for the top
Joint one edge and one face of each top board, plane to a consistent 1-3/4".
Lay the six boards out and shuffle for grain. Alternate the end-grain arcs so any cupping cancels rather than compounds. Mark a V across them.
Tools: Parallel Clamps. Materials: Wood glue
Do it in two halves of three boards rather than all six at once. Six joints closing at the same time with glue setting is more than two hands can manage well.
Use cauls across the top and bottom to keep the panel flat. Glue the two halves together the next day. Overnight cure each time.
Tools: Random Orbit Sander, Router
A 36" x 72" slab won't fit any planer you own. Options: a router sled, a belt sander and a long straight-edge, hand planes, or pay a shop with a wide sander.
Trim the ends square with a track saw or a circular saw against a clamped straight-edge. Final: 36" x 72".
Tools: Chisels, Router. Materials: White oak or ash, 8/4, for the trestle base
Each trestle: a foot, a post, and a top cleat. Mortise-and-tenon the post into both.
Shape the feet — a curve or a chamfered taper — so the table doesn't look like it's standing on bricks. This is where the design lives.
Tools: Chisels. Materials: White oak or ash, 8/4, for the trestle base
The stretcher passes through a through-mortise in each post and is locked with a tapered wedge.
It's the classic trestle joint and it's not just decorative — the stretcher is what stops the table from racking when someone leans on the end. Cut it snug and wedge it tight.
Tools: Drill / Driver, Router. Materials: Figure-8 tabletop fasteners
Read this twice. Rout shallow recesses in the top cleats for figure-8 fasteners. Screw one side into the cleat, the other into the underside of the top.
The fasteners pivot, which lets the top expand and contract across its width — up to 1/4" seasonally on a 36" oak top.
Do not screw the top down through the cleats. It will look fine for six months and then split, and there is no fixing it. This step is why the table lasts.
Tools: Random Orbit Sander. Materials: Clear interior finish (hardwax oil or wipe-on poly), Sandpaper, assorted grits
Sand the top to 180 (with hardwax oil) or 220 (with film finish). Don't go finer for oil — it burnishes the surface closed and the finish won't penetrate.
Finish the top *and the underside*. An unfinished underside absorbs and releases moisture at a different rate than the top, and that imbalance cups the slab. Both faces, same coats.
Tools: Drill / Driver. Materials: Figure-8 tabletop fasteners
Set the base where it belongs, drop the top on, drive the figure-8 screws.
